band1 a group of people or animals acting together.
engine a machine that uses energy from a source such as gasoline or electricity to do work.
female being a member of the sex that produces eggs and gives birth.
holder an object used for holding.
lay1 to put something down so that it is flat against a surface.
loaf a single quantity of bread the way it is just after it is baked and before it is cut into slices.
mayor the head of government in a village, town, or city.
ocean a part of the large body of salt water that covers most of the earth's surface.
practice To repeat something in order to do it better.
provide to give (what is needed); supply.
remember to bring into your mind from your memory.
shelf a thin, flat piece of wood, metal, or other material that is attached to a wall or set into a piece of furniture. Shelves are used to hold books, dishes, and other things.
stain a spot or colored mark.
town an area with streets, houses, and buildings that is similar to a city but usually smaller.
trick to deceive someone.
